5-Amino-1-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razole-4-carboxylic acid is a versatile compound widely used in chemical synthesis. Its primary application lies in its role as a key building block in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Specifically, this compound serves as a crucial intermediate in the production of bioactive molecules and heterocyclic compounds. With its unique structure and functional groups, 5-Amino-1-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razole-4-carboxylic acid facilitates the formation of complex chemical structures through the establishment of important molecular connections. In medicinal chemistry, this compound is instrumental in the development of potential drug candidates due to its ability to impart desirable pharmacological properties. Additionally, its incorporation in chemical synthesis processes enables the efficient creation of novel compounds with diverse applications across different industries.
